Fish Recheado Masala Recipe a spicy, tangy, shallow fried fish is a traditional Goan recipe. Recheado masala is a red paste which is filled with stuffing in fishes like pomfret and mackerel. Me and my sister have grown up eating this fish and I just love them. In-fact I am not so fond of mackerel but when rechead is filled in it just love mackerels then.
This red paste is made mainly with kashmiri red chilies, spices, ginger, garlic and vinegar. The fish is marinated with this red paste and could be kept overnight in the freezer or for 40-45 mins. If you are using a pomfret or a mackerel fish then ensure the sticky part near the head is removed. The fish has to be sliced from the center but don’t split apart. Just make a small 3-4 incision over the fish.Rub this paste and fill in the stomach area and cover the fish with the paste. It’s generally shallow fried but if you want crispy fish then coat with semolina and flour then fry the fish.

You could also make this paste and store them in the freezer section for further usage. In-fact I marinated some potatoes in the left-over paste and then shallow fried. It tasted quite delicious. If you are a vegetarian then marinate veggies like mushroom, potatoes and then shallow fry them.
There are a lot of version to this dish I have stuck to the basic. Secondly, my mom soak’s the spices and red chilies for 30-40 mins then grind them together. Some add vinegar towards the end. But I love my mom’s recipe hence followed it to the tee.
How to make Fish Recheado Masala with mackerels:
1. Soak all the spices, ginger, garlic, tamarind pulp and kashmiri chilies except oil in vinegar. Adding cinnamon is optional for this recipe.
2. Add sugar and salt.
3. Also add turmeric powder.Combine all nicely and marinate for 35-40 mins.
4. Grind the mixture until soft and smooth.
5. Add more vinegar if required but ensure the paste has to be thick so add vinegar accordingly. If the masala paste is thin then it would not stick to the fish.
6. Rinse the fish slit from the center and give some incision from the top. Just remove the sticky stuff from the mouth area keeping the eyes intact. You could see the fish below for clarity.
7. Now stuff the paste into the center and into the incision. Coat the entire fish with this paste. Marinate the fish for 30 mins.
8. Place oil in a shallow pan, once oil is quite hot shallow fry the stuffed mackerels.
9. Fry until golden brown from both sides.
10. Serve the recheado mackerels hot with salad, lime wedges, rice and curry.

Ingredients
- 4 mackerels rinsed, slit within the center and 2-3 incision from the top (bangda)
- 17-18 dry red kashmiri chilies
- 1 inch ginger chopped
- 7-8 garlic cloves
- 1.5 tsp pepper corn
- 1 tsp cumin seed
- 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
- 2 one inch cinnamon stick[b] (optional)[/b]
- 4-5 cloves
- 2 green cardamom
- 1 tbsp sugar
- 2 marble sized tamarind ball without seed or pulp
- 2.5 tbsp vinegar or as required
- salt as required
- oil for shallow frying
Instructions
- Soak all the spices, ginger, garlic, tamarind pulp and kashmiri chilies except oil in vinegar.
- Add sugar and salt.
- Also add turmeric powder.
- Combine all nicely and marinate for 35-40 mins.
- Grind the mixture until soft and smooth. Add more vinegar if required but ensure the paste has to be thick so add vinegar accordingly. If the masala paste is thin then it would not stick to the fish.
- Rinse the fish slit from the center and give some incision from the top. You could see the fish below for clarity.
- Now stuff the paste into the center and into the incision. Coat the entire fish with this paste. Marinate the fish for 30 mins.
- Place oil in a shallow pan, once oil is quite hot shallow fry the stuffed mackerels.
- Fry until golden brown from both sides
- Serve the recheado mackerels hot with salad, lime wedges, rice and curry.
Notes
1. Ensure the masala paste is thick else the result won’t be good.[br]2. If you aren’t able to find kashmiri chilies then use bedgi chilies or kashmiri red chili powder.[br]3. You could use white vinegar or coconut vinegar.[br]4. Any left over paste could be stored in the fridge for future use.[br]5. Cinnamon could be avoided as it’s a strong spice used generally for meat or chicken.
